77问答网
所有问题
当前搜索:
c语言中int转char
c语言中
如何将short,
int
,long,float这些类型的数值
转换为
字符串?_百 ...
答:
不过更通用
的
做法是使用sprintf函数。2、声明:
int
sprintf(
char
*dst, const char *format_string, ...);头文件为stdio.h。3、功能:sprintf是一个不定参数函数,根据format_string中提供的格式符,将后续参数转为字符串存储在第一个参数dst中。4、使用示例:short a=1;int b=2;long c=3;...
c语言中
float怎样
转换为int
答:
在
C语言中
,将一个浮点数变换成整数的示例:main(){ float f=5.75;printf("f=%d,f=%f\n",(int)f,f);} 执行程序,输出结果为f=5,f=5.750000。 f=5即为由浮点数转化出的整数。上述示例中f虽强制
转为int
型,但只在运算中起作用, 是临时的,而f本身的类型并不改变。因此,(int)f的...
C语言
字符
转换成
整形
的
方法是什么?
答:
转换有两种方法:第一种用“atoi”
的
:#include "stdio.h"#include "stdlib.h"#include "conio.h"void main(){
char
str[1024] = {0};
int
Interger;printf("输入一个数字:\n");scanf("%s", str);Interger = atoi(str);printf("
转换为
整形:%d\n", Interger);getch();}第二种:#...
C语言
十进制转二进制
答:
十进制转二进制可以使用库函数itoa。itoa函数原型:
char
*itoa(
int
value,char*string,int radix);功能:将任意类型的数字
转换为
字符串。在<stdlib.h>中与之有相反功能的函数是atoi。nt value 被
转换的
整数,char *string 转换后储存的字符数组,int radix 转换进制数,如2,8,10,16 进制等。
c语言中
的数据怎么
转换成
二进制?
答:
c语言中
没有表示二进制的字符,但是你可以根据十进制、八进制或者十六进制转换一下。可以利用短除法,将十进制转变成二进制,我们一般的思路是这样的,下面给出一个例子:把20
转换成
二进制:20/2=10...余数为0 最低位10/2=5...余数为05/2=2...余数为12/2=1...余数为01/2=0...余...
c语言int
、 float、
char
有什么区别?
答:
1、表示
的
数据范围不同
int
是-32768~32767之间的整数,超过范围表示不下,小数也表示不了;
char
表示-128~127之间的整数,或者A、B、
C
、D等一个字符;float可以表示小数,而且范围很大,一般是10的-37次方~10的38次方之间。2、字符类型不同 int为整数型,用于定义整数类型的数据 ;float为单精度浮点...
求
c语言
各种常用函数原型写法
答:
double poly(double x,
int
n,double c[])从参数产生一个多项式 double modf(double value,double *iptr)将双精度数value分解成尾数和阶 double fmod(double x,double y) 返回x/y的余数 double frexp(double value,int *eptr) 将双精度数value分成尾数和阶 double atof(
char
*nptr) 将字符串nptr
转换成
浮点...
c语言中
的
char
的作用?
答:
3、在
int
型和
char
型中变量相互赋值。整型和字符型是互通的,他们是在内存中存储的本质是相同的,只是存储的范围不同而已,整型可以是2字节,4字节,8字节,而字符型只占1字节。char用于C或C++中定义字符型变量,只占一个字节,
C语言中
如int、long、short等不指定signed或unsigned时都默认为signed,但...
C语言
类型强制
转换的
注意事项
答:
2.无论是强制转换或是自动转换,都只是为了本次运算
的
需要而对变量的数据长度进行的临时性转换,而不改变数据说明时对该变量定义的类型。例1:main(){float f=5.75;printf(f=%d,f=%f\n,(int)f,f);}f=5,f=5.750000将float f强制
转换成int
f float f=5.75;printf((int)f=%d,f=%f\n...
c语言中
put
char
是什么意思
答:
put
char
是
c语言
函数之一,作用是向终端输出一个字符。其格式为putchar(c),其中c可以是被单引号(英文状态下)引起来
的
一个字符,可以是介于0~127之间的一个十进制整型数(包含0和127),也可以是事先用char定义好的一个字符型变量。putchar函数的基本格式为:putchar(c)。1、当c为一个被单引号...
棣栭〉
<涓婁竴椤
10
11
12
13
15
16
17
18
19
涓嬩竴椤
灏鹃〉
14
其他人还搜